After a win on Saturday, with Tudgay going off injured and Leon Clarke scoring in his 1st start of the season, Laws picks him for the injured Tudgay against Palace.

More Purse mistakes follow in the game at Selhurt Park, and luckily Palace can't shoot straight.

Leon Clarke has countless efforts on goal, and like any striker does one in a while, he misses. Every players has an off day, and this day was Clarkes.

At the end of the game, we were fortunate not to lose, but unlicky not to win if you get my meaning.

Instead of critisising Purse for his contless mistakes, he lays onto Leon Clarke, and says he wouldn't have scored if he was playing all night.

Bad dicision. Sodje isn't fit and Varney can't play, so pulling Clarke's confidence down before his 1st start is appauling.

Drop Purse for god sake. Critisise Buxton for being outdone in the last 11 games. Tell Miller he has to start playing or he will be out. If that was Tudgay it wouldn't have happened.

Looks like Laws is one of those people who look to the nearest person to critisize. Leon Clarke.

Leon is clearly a confidence player, so I agree it's maybe not ideal for Laws to be commenting in such a manner. But I'm sure him and Clarke will have spoken after the game, there's no major issue here for me. On another night, he'd have scored a couple, lets hope that happens sooner rather than later.

You mentioned Purse, so I should add that I thought he was very good last night, and the clean sheet certainly won't have done his confidence any harm.

While I take the point about Jeffers and Purse being far from great signings, a dose of reality is required. Brian's record in the transfer market has been described as "hit or miss", and I agree. But can we honestly expect any better with the extremely limited funds at our disposal? Guaranteeing that every signing will be a decent player is very difficult even with a massive transfer budget...it's pretty much impossible with the amounts of money we've been able to spend.

With one of the lowest wage bills in the Championship, Brian Laws has had us consistently punching above our weight in this division, and is doing an excellent job IMO.
